Set amidst Victoria's picturesque high country, 'Ancona Station' spans an impressive 1,004.32 acres, showcasing both the region's natural beauty and its significant agricultural potential. Located in the highly desirable corridor between Melbourne and Lake Eildon/Mansfield, this property offers a rare opportunity to acquire substantial rural land within a 2.5-hour drive of Australia's second-largest city.
The landscape features fertile alluvial creek flats and gently rolling grazing lands, making it ideal for a diverse range of agricultural operations. With numerous reliable catchment stock dams, the property is perfectly suited for intensive livestock management. Its capacity to support a large breeding herd, with potential for increased production, makes 'Ancona Station' an excellent investment for both experienced graziers and those seeking a rural lifestyle.
'Ancona North' complements the quality landholding with a charming historic weatherboard homestead, featuring four bedrooms, a spacious lounge with a wood-fired heater, split system air conditioning, and a recently painted exterior. Set within a picturesque garden of mature English trees, this property is ideal for renovation and offers classic appeal with established surrounds.
Essential infrastructure supports a successful farming enterprise, including well-maintained shedding, livestock yards, and shearing facilitiesall designed to enhance operational efficiency.
Managed by the same family since 1982, 'Ancona Station' represents a legacy of dedication to beef or sheep farming.
